Pumpkin Day!

This week we finished our week off with Pumpkin Day! Most of us wore orange in celebration of inspecting the inside of a pumpkin! The squirmy faces were priceless when we not only smelled the pumpkin, but touched the pulp and seeds in the inside! "Gross!" "So slimey!"  






We separated the seeds and then estimated how many seeds the pumpkin had. Our estimations varied from 22-500. 





After counting the seeds, our class pumpkin had 96 seeds! Some of our estimations were close... 

After counting, we boiled the seeds in salt water, rinsed them, then put them in the oven for 12 minutes. 

Most of us got to try pumpkin seeds for the first time! They were delicious!
